Output 12c5518353e7e8d33e247fd54ca6d93b0e1e324a7fe9ed553b31af0faed46651:1

value
3990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52cca00688a96ef1e5c260f0a9a209426471a4f0 OP_EQUAL
address
39EpTshqqdRYVKUYPm1frMSXVBPHV2Pw5s
transaction
12c5518353e7e8d33e247fd54ca6d93b0e1e324a7fe9ed553b31af0faed46651
spent
true